This book introduces Watsu®, the world’s first Aquatic Bodywork, and the newest forms of Explorer and Tandem Watsu, as well as Tantsuyoga which brings Watsu’s unconditional holding and the movement of water onto land. Watsu is the practice of floating and stretching people in warm water in a way that creates enough safety in our arms for them to access whatever level of being they need to free and heal.
